Cost Insights: Adobe Inc. vs. ON Semiconductor Corporation

In the ever-evolving landscape of technology, understanding cost structures is crucial for investors and analysts alike. This chart provides a decade-long view of the cost of revenue for Adobe Inc. and ON Semiconductor Corporation, two giants in their respective fields. Adobe's cost of revenue has seen a steady increase, growing by approximately 280% from 2014 to 2023. In contrast, ON Semiconductor's costs have surged by about 110% over the same period, reflecting its aggressive expansion strategy.

Key Insights

  • Adobe Inc.: From 2014 to 2023, Adobe's cost of revenue rose from 620 million to 2.35 billion, highlighting its investment in cloud services and digital media.
  • ON Semiconductor: Despite a similar upward trend, ON Semiconductor's costs peaked in 2023 at 4.37 billion, indicating a focus on scaling operations.
